logo

Output 61eca153258e72356cb9f24831daca09a99171df387b0d6c498ae1024e3d5639:0

value
47681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6e3af109ecafa31eb58f7512a004ab80a99407 OP_EQUAL
address
3EJyDwvQwvfb85i7euN8akstiXLw7a3fcZ
transaction
61eca153258e72356cb9f24831daca09a99171df387b0d6c498ae1024e3d5639